Output 88df7351c9b72fa45154f84a10de337440c31bf500054819f94efab08f15c032:0

value
21556000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ab2974209eda1033fe1d1f17abf2fc478998c477 OP_EQUAL
address
MPWBSUsf7zNCKPX8zjArd2jdjKC5bEaooF
transaction
88df7351c9b72fa45154f84a10de337440c31bf500054819f94efab08f15c032
spent
true